Post irradiation examinations of twenty years stored spent fuel

Full text: The post irradiation examinations (PIE) of stored spent fuels were carried out to evaluate fuel integrity during storage. The spent MOX (Mixed Oxide) fuels irradiated in commercial BWR and the spent PWR-UO2 fuel irradiated in commercial PWR were used. The burnup of MOX fuels was about 20 MWd/kgHM and that of PWR-UO2 was about 58MWd/kgHM. Five fuels from MOX fuel assembly were stored under two different storage conditions for twenty years: Three fuel rods of them were stored under wet condition (in water). Other two rods were stored under dry condition (in air) in capsule after cutting to short length segments. For PWR-UO2 fuel, a fuel pin was stored under dry condition (in air) for twenty years. For MOX fuel, the pre-storage characterization data of fuels, which were symmetry position in the fuel assembly during irradiation, were used to compare with the post-storage PIE results. The following PIE items were carried out for MOX fuel in this study. For wet storage fuel : a) Visual inspection of the cladding outer surface, b) Puncture test. For dry storage fuel : c) Atmosphere gas analysis in capsule, d) Ceramographic examination to observe oxide layer thickness on outside/inside cladding and pellet microstructure such as grain size. For PWR-UO2 fuel, PIE items including cladding were carried out to evaluate fuel integrity during storage. The results show no marked difference after storage of MOX and PWR-UO2 fuels. However, further examination is required to conclude on spent fuel integrity during long term storage. (author)
